- The distance between Tauranga, New Zealand and Mosnov, Czech Republic is approximately 17,816 km or 11,071 mi.
- To reach Tauranga in this distance one would set out from Mosnov bearing 60.8°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tauranga bearing 134.5° or SE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Tauranga is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Mosnov is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 6.2 °C (11.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.6 °C (19.1°F) less in Tauranga.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 591.1 mm (23.3 in) more which is equivalent to 591.1 l/m² (14.51 US gal/ft²) or 5,911,000 l/ha (631,925 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.3° higher in Tauranga than in Mosnov.
